Lexo believes that the smallest corners often hold the greatest warmth — and today, she invites us into a softly lit nook inside her Second Life home where intention and style meet. This wasn’t just about decor — it was about creating presence, softness, and a sense of belonging.

The space is grounded by a plush, vintage-style armchair. Right beside it stands a metallic, curved-leg side table, crowned with a unique ceramic lamp — the base featuring a textured glaze that looks like it was kissed by fire and sea.

Above the armchair, a bold abstract painting draws the eye. Rich in emerald, turquoise, and amber tones, its organic forms feel alive — as if the foliage in the painting might shift in the breeze. It ties the corner together with a touch of expressive elegance.

To the right, two arched metal wall shelves add vertical interest, showcasing minimalistic ceramic vases in matte white. A single sprig of greenery in one adds just enough life without overcomplicating the scene.

On the floor, a beautiful monstera plant anchors the room with its wide, graceful leaves and sculptural silhouette — a grounding presence against the earth-toned walls and muted palette.

For Lexo, this corner isn't just about sitting — it’s about pausing. It’s where thoughts settle, tea is sipped slowly, and the world outside softens. Sometimes, a chair, a lamp, and a little art are all you need to feel like you're exactly where you’re meant to be.
